The discussion between Rubiales and Lopetegui before the sacking

In what Florentino Perez described as an act of transparency, Rubiales could only see an act of betrayal and disloyalty to the national side. One thing that is for certain is that a new chapter has been written in the history of the Spanish team, a chapter that will never be forgotten.
Just two days before the World Cup in Russia, Real Madrid announced an agreemt with Lopetegui to join the club after the tournament. The manager signed for 'Los Blancos' and decided to make the news public as to avoid leaks and to be open with theSpanish public.
However, Rubiales was only informed of the decision at the last minute and took the values of the Spanish FA to their extreme.
The president of the FA landed in Krasnodar, the team's base, and announced a press conference for the following day, the same day in which he spent in a meeting that lasted more than hour which resulted in the most controversial outcome possible, that Lopetegui should return to Madrid.
The newspaper 'Marca' has tried to compile what happened in the hours leading up to the sacking and how the decision came about. Rubiales was in his office until the early hours of the morning with Lopetegui and Hierro visiting him.
Rubiales looked at his options and, as the newspaper states, had reached his decision by the time talks had recomenced at 8 a.m. At this the time head of the FA could not believe what was happening.
Rubiales told Lopetegui that his best option would be to resign, something which the former-Spain coach could not agree to: "I'm not resigning. If you want me to leave, you'll have to sack me".
The heavy hitters in the Spanish team met with Rubiales to try and convince him not to get rid of Lopetegui, that it wouldn't make sense to do so.
But the president went into to the press conference and announced that Lopetegui had to pack up his things, with the coach having to leave just 48 hours before the team's first match.
